Be careful, as different types of solar cells can provide a varying quantity of energy. You can determine the energy production quickly, but: after you construct your DIY solar panel , measure the existing and voltage it creates, and multiply them to obtain the w value. Consequently, a small, 6 ampere solar panel that produces 12 volts, as an example, can present about 72 watts.

The rate and efficiency with which solar cells can change solar power in to energy also represents a part in deciding how many solar panels you’ll need. In the case of panels using monocrystalline solar cells, like, the amount of sunlight needed for generating a particular level of power is much less than in the event of slim picture or polycrystalline cells.
This year, a business that produces top quality monocrystalline solar panels surely could break the world history for solar energy efficiency, producing solar cells that can change significantly more than 24 % of the sun’s rays in to usable electrical power.
Some scientists even consider that, in a few years, it might be probable to produce monocrystalline solar cells that are able to exceed the 30 % or even the 40 % tag, considerably increasing the effectiveness standing of these kind of solar cells, and that of solar energy in general.
A good example of the power efficiency these solar panels can provide could be that a solar panel employing a overall of 36 monocrystalline cells can typically create around 100 to 130 watts. This practically indicates that if you want to get 1 kw (1000 watts), you will be needing about 10 of these panels. Depending on the quality and make of the panel , pricing can selection between $3000 and $5000 for this plan.
In contrast with one of these results, systems using polycrystalline cells are hardly ready to get near the 20 % limit today, while thin movie based systems barely provide about 15 to 17 % efficiency www.poweruprenewableenergy.com.
These numbers may conclude the technical superiority of monocrystalline PV cells, but they cannot demonstrate that the very best choice is to buy such panels. It’s true you will not want as many panels to reach a broad productivity around 1 to 3 kw in this instance, but the thing is that the more monocrystalline solar panels you purchase, the greater the price big difference becomes.
You may also opt for less power effectiveness and an improved pricing option in order to save your self money. In that respect, polycrystalline cells are greater, as they are not as weak as slim film-based systems, and are relatively less costly than monocrystalline solar cells.
